Afghanistan, July 11 -- The UK Ministry of Defence approved only 2.04% of 17,625 Afghan relocation requests in early 2025, raising concerns over eligibility criteria.

The latest statistics from the UK Ministry of Defence reveal that in the first half of 2025, less than three percent of Afghanistan's applicants under the Afghan Relocations and Assistance Policy (ARAP) were deemed eligible.

Between January 1 and June 30, 2025, a total of 17,625 primary applications were received for the ARAP program. Out of these, only 73 applications - approximately 2.04% - were approved.
